Delhi Police officials have confirmed that 2 FIRs have been filed against former WFI President Brijbhushan Sharan Singh over sexual harassment allegations.
The police officials confirmed that both FIRs have been registered at the Connaught Place Police Station.

The first FIR pertains to allegations levelled by a minor victim which has been registered under the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(POCSO) Act, while the second pertains to outraging modesty.
Under POCSO Act, the accused has to be taken into remand by the police and it remains to be seen when former WFI Chief is taken into custody by Delhi Police.
